About

Joshua Ravishankar is a rising researcher at the intersection of robotics and artificial intelligence, with a primary focus on human-robot interaction (HRI) and data-driven learning systems. His work addresses a critical challenge in deploying autonomous robots: enabling them to recognize and recover from their own errors without requiring extensive human supervision. In his highly-cited 2024 paper, "Zero-Shot Learning to Enable Error Awareness in Data-Driven HRI," Ravishankar pioneers a novel approach that leverages zero-shot learning to detect mistakes in social imitation learning—a method where robots learn behaviors from minimal human demonstration. This contribution is particularly impactful because it eliminates the need for costly data labeling, making error detection scalable and practical for real-world HRI applications. While still early in his career, with his most-cited work accumulating three citations, Ravishankar’s research promises to make robots more robust and trustworthy in dynamic social environments.
